Welcome to Prospect Lefferts Gardens
A residential gem with historic charm and park-side living
Prospect Lefferts Gardens, often called PLG, sits just east of Prospect Park and combines historic architecture with cultural diversity. Known for its elegant limestone townhouses and tree-lined streets, the neighborhood offers a quieter, more affordable alternative to nearby Prospect Heights and Park Slope. Its proximity to Prospect Park makes it a haven for families and nature lovers.

Local Lifestyle
Life in PLG is residential and community-driven. Families, professionals, and longtime residents enjoy a balanced pace of life, with plenty of local businesses and green spaces. The neighborhood is peaceful yet well-connected by subway lines, offering easy access to Manhattan and the rest of Brooklyn.
Dining, Entertainment, & Shopping
Flatbush Avenue and Rogers Avenue offer a mix of Caribbean eateries, coffee shops, and growing nightlife. Trendy cafes and small restaurants continue to emerge, reflecting the area’s evolving character. Local shops focus on essentials and community needs.
Things to Do
Spend weekends exploring Prospect Park, visit the nearby Brooklyn Botanic Garden, or attend neighborhood block parties and festivals. The area’s strong cultural diversity is celebrated in local events and gatherings.
